Elaine Yankee Obituary

Elaine H. Yankee, age 86, a life long Beloiter, died Monday January 14, 2019 in her home. She was born March 26, 1931 to the late Henry and Vi (Burdick) Buchberger in Clintonville, WI. Elaine graduated from Clintonville Memorial High School, Class of 1949.  She met Kurtis L. Yankee in High School and they married on June 2, 1950 in Milwaukee.  She was a 50+ year member of St. Paul Lutheran Church in Beloit. Elaine & Kurt also operated a real estate rental business in Beloit for many years.  She was a superb homemaker and  enjoyed tending to her flower garden. Elaine cherished the many sporting events she attended for her two sons and her grandchildren. Later in life, she enjoyed visiting with her elderly friends.

She is survived by her two sons, Paul (Fran) Yankee and Brian (Teri) Yankee; three grandchildren and her two great grandchildren.

She was preceded in death by her parents, her sister and four brothers.
